2. Choose the Right Resizing Method

When resizing an image, it’s essential to select the appropriate method. The most common methods are:

Nearest Neighbor: This method is the fastest but produces the least accurate results. It’s best used for simple tasks like resizing icons or small images.
Bilinear: Bilinear interpolation is a good middle ground between speed and quality. It’s suitable for most general-purpose resizing tasks.
Bicubic: Bicubic interpolation is the most accurate and time-consuming method. It’s ideal for enlarging images with complex details, such as photographs and illustrations.

5. Apply Sharpening and Noise Reduction

After resizing the image, you may notice that the image appears slightly blurred or pixelated. To address this issue, apply sharpening and noise reduction techniques. Most image editing software offers these tools, allowing you to fine-tune the image’s sharpness and clarity.
